Home
last modified time | relevance | path

Searched defs:reg_ctx (Results 1 – 25 of 39) sorted by relevance

12

/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ObjectFile/Minidump/
H A DMinidumpFileBuilder.cpp296 read_register_u16_raw(RegisterContext * reg_ctx,llvm::StringRef reg_name) read_register_u16_raw() argument
308 read_register_u32_raw(RegisterContext * reg_ctx,llvm::StringRef reg_name) read_register_u32_raw() argument
320 read_register_u64_raw(RegisterContext * reg_ctx,llvm::StringRef reg_name) read_register_u64_raw() argument
332 read_register_u16(RegisterContext * reg_ctx,llvm::StringRef reg_name) read_register_u16() argument
338 read_register_u32(RegisterContext * reg_ctx,llvm::StringRef reg_name) read_register_u32() argument
344 read_register_u64(RegisterContext * reg_ctx,llvm::StringRef reg_name) read_register_u64() argument
350 read_register_u128(RegisterContext * reg_ctx,llvm::StringRef reg_name,uint8_t * dst) read_register_u128() argument
368 GetThreadContext_x86_64(RegisterContext * reg_ctx) GetThreadContext_x86_64() argument
403 GetThreadContext_ARM64(RegisterContext * reg_ctx) GetThreadContext_ARM64() argument
438 prepareRegisterContext(RegisterContext * reg_ctx) prepareRegisterContext() argument
519 RegisterContext *reg_ctx = reg_ctx_sp.get(); AddThreadList() local
[all...]
/freebsd-src/contrib/llvm-project/lldb/source/Commands/
H A DCommandObjectRegister.cpp91 DumpRegister(const ExecutionContext & exe_ctx,Stream & strm,RegisterContext & reg_ctx,const RegisterInfo & reg_info,bool print_flags) DumpRegister() argument
126 DumpRegisterSet(const ExecutionContext & exe_ctx,Stream & strm,RegisterContext * reg_ctx,size_t set_idx,bool primitive_only=false) DumpRegisterSet() argument
166 RegisterContext *reg_ctx = m_exe_ctx.GetRegisterContext(); DoExecute() local
352 RegisterContext *reg_ctx = m_exe_ctx.GetRegisterContext(); DoExecute() local
455 RegisterContext *reg_ctx = m_exe_ctx.GetRegisterContext(); DoExecute() local
[all...]
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/X86/
H A DABIMacOSX_i386.cpp65 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
147 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
203 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
270 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ectImpl() local
H A DABISysV_i386.cpp87 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
165 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
216 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
362 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ectSimple() local
H A DABISysV_x86_64.cpp129 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
224 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
310 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
398 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ectSimple() local
H A DABIWindows_x86_64.cpp145 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
239 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
317 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
407 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ectSimple() local
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/PowerPC/
H A DABISysV_ppc64.cpp102 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
233 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); GetArgumentValues() local
314 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); SetReturnValueObject() local
411 Register(Type ty,uint32_t index,uint32_t offs,RegisterContext * reg_ctx,ByteOrder byte_order) Register() argument
418 Register(Type ty,uint32_t index,RegisterContext * reg_ctx,ByteOrder byte_order) Register() argument
423 Register(uint32_t offs,RegisterContext * reg_ctx,ByteOrder byte_order) Register() argument
502 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); Create() local
569 ReturnValueExtractor(Thread & thread,CompilerType & type,RegisterContext * reg_ctx,ProcessSP process_sp) ReturnValueExtractor() argument
[all...]
H A DABISysV_ppc.cpp250 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
345 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
435 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
518 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ectSimple() local
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/ARM/
H A DABISysV_arm.cpp1329 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
1441 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
1511 RegisterContext *reg_ctx, in GetReturnValuePassedInMemory()
1553 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ectImpl() local
1850 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
H A DABIMacOSX_arm.cpp1325 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
1437 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
1551 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ectImpl() local
1705 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/AArch64/
H A DABISysV_arm64.cpp66 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
131 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); GetArgumentValues() local
227 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); SetReturnValueObject() local
457 LoadValueFromConsecutiveGPRRegisters(ExecutionContext & exe_ctx,RegisterContext * reg_ctx,const CompilerType & value_type,bool is_return_value,uint32_t & NGRN,uint32_t & NSRN,DataExtractor & data) LoadValueFromConsecutiveGPRRegisters() argument
608 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); GetReturnValueObjectImpl() local
[all...]
H A DABIMacOSX_arm64.cpp63 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
129 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); GetArgumentValues() local
255 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); SetReturnValueObject() local
483 LoadValueFromConsecutiveGPRRegisters(ExecutionContext & exe_ctx,RegisterContext * reg_ctx,const CompilerType & value_type,bool is_return_value,uint32_t & NGRN,uint32_t & NSRN,DataExtractor & data) LoadValueFromConsecutiveGPRRegisters() argument
638 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); GetReturnValueObjectImpl() local
[all...]
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/RISCV/
H A DABISysV_riscv.cpp176 auto reg_ctx = thread.GetRegisterContext(); PrepareTrivialCall() local
303 auto &reg_ctx = *frame_sp->GetThread()->GetRegisterContext(); SetReturnValueObject() local
412 GetValObjFromIntRegs(Thread & thread,const RegisterContextSP & reg_ctx,llvm::Triple::ArchType machine,uint32_t type_flags,uint32_t byte_size) GetValObjFromIntRegs() argument
486 GetValObjFromFPRegs(Thread & thread,const RegisterContextSP & reg_ctx,llvm::Triple::ArchType machine,uint32_t arch_fp_flags,uint32_t type_flags,uint32_t byte_size) GetValObjFromFPRegs() argument
537 auto reg_ctx = thread.GetRegisterContext(); GetReturnValueObjectSimple() local
588 auto reg_ctx = thread.GetRegisterContext(); GetReturnValueObjectImpl() local
[all...]
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/UnwindAssembly/x86/
H A DUnwindAssembly-x86.cpp59 RegisterContextSP reg_ctx(thread.GetRegisterContext()); in GetNonCallSiteUnwindPlanFromAssembly() local
160 RegisterContextSP reg_ctx(thread.GetRegisterContext()); in AugmentUnwindPlanFromCallSite() local
/freebsd-src/contrib/llvm-project/lldb/source/Target/
H A DThreadPlanTracer.cpp136 RegisterContext *reg_ctx = GetThread().GetRegisterContext().get(); in Log() local
212 RegisterContext *reg_ctx = GetThread().GetRegisterContext().get(); in Log() local
H A DThreadPlan.cpp123 RegisterContext *reg_ctx = GetThread().GetRegisterContext().get(); in WillResume() local
/freebsd-src/lib/libc/aarch64/gen/
H A Dgetcontextx.c46 struct arm64_reg_context *reg_ctx; in __fillcontextx2() local
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/ARC/
H A DABISysV_arc.cpp199 auto reg_ctx = thread.GetRegisterContext(); in PrepareTrivialCall() local
325 auto &reg_ctx = *frame_sp->GetThread()->GetRegisterContext(); in SetReturnValueObject() local
427 static uint64_t ReadRawValue(const RegisterContextSP &reg_ctx, in ReadRawValue()
451 auto reg_ctx = thread.GetRegisterContext(); in GetReturnValueObjectSimple() local
513 auto reg_ctx = thread.GetRegisterContext(); in GetReturnValueObjectImpl() local
/freebsd-src/contrib/llvm-project/lldb/source/Core/
H A DValueObjectVariable.cpp367 RegisterContext *reg_ctx = exe_ctx.GetRegisterContext(); SetValueFromCString() local
396 RegisterContext *reg_ctx = exe_ctx.GetRegisterContext(); SetData() local
H A DValueObjectRegister.cpp54 lldb::RegisterContextSP &reg_ctx, in ValueObjectRegisterSet() argument
186 ValueObjectRegister(ExecutionContextScope * exe_scope,ValueObjectManager & manager,lldb::RegisterContextSP & reg_ctx,const RegisterInfo * reg_info) ValueObjectRegister() argument
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/SystemZ/
H A DABISysV_s390x.cpp216 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
315 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etArgumentValues() local
398 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
485 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ectSimple() local
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/Hexagon/
H A DABISysV_hexagon.cpp1061 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
1289 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ectImpl() local
/freebsd-src/contrib/llvm-project/lldb/source/Plugins/ABI/Mips/
H A DABISysV_mips.cpp587 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
720 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
799 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ectImpl() local
H A DABISysV_mips64.cpp585 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in PrepareTrivialCall() local
678 RegisterContext *reg_ctx = thread->GetRegisterContext().get(); in SetReturnValueObject() local
750 RegisterContext *reg_ctx = thread.GetRegisterContext().get(); in GetReturnValueObjectImpl() local
/freebsd-src/contrib/llvm-project/lldb/source/Expression/
H A DDWARFExpression.cpp98 ReadRegisterValueAsScalar(RegisterContext * reg_ctx,lldb::RegisterKind reg_kind,uint32_t reg_num,Status * error_ptr,Value & value) ReadRegisterValueAsScalar() argument
546 Evaluate_DW_OP_entry_value(std::vector<Value> & stack,ExecutionContext * exe_ctx,RegisterContext * reg_ctx,const DataExtractor & opcodes,lldb::offset_t & opcode_offset,Status * error_ptr,Log * log) Evaluate_DW_OP_entry_value() argument
867 Evaluate(ExecutionContext * exe_ctx,RegisterContext * reg_ctx,lldb::ModuleSP module_sp,const DataExtractor & opcodes,const DWARFUnit * dwarf_cu,const lldb::RegisterKind reg_kind,const Value * initial_value_ptr,const Value * object_address_ptr,Value & result,Status * error_ptr) Evaluate() argument
[all...]

12